Application Examples of 316L stainless steel sheet
316L stainless steel sheet, as a common type of stainless steel material, has been widely used in various industrial fields due to its excellent corrosion resistance and mechanical properties. This material contains a relatively low amount of carbon and is supplemented with molybdenum, which enables it to exhibit better stability under specific conditions. The following will list several specific application examples to demonstrate its practical uses.
1. Food processing equipment manufacturing. In the food industry, hygiene standards are very high, and the equipment needs to be frequently cleaned and come into contact with various food raw materials. 316L stainless steel sheet are used to manufacture components such as storage tanks, conveying pipes, and mixing containers. Due to its corrosion resistance, it can resist the erosion of acidic foods such as juices or seasonings, avoiding material contamination of food. The smooth surface is easy to clean, which helps maintain the hygiene standards of the production environment. In actual production, such equipment is usually processed using 316L stainless steel sheet to ensure the reliability of long-term use.
2. Chemical containers and pipeline systems. In the chemical industry, materials often come into contact with corrosive media, such as acids, alkalis, or salt solutions. 316L stainless steel sheet are used to manufacture reaction vessels, storage tanks, and pipelines, due to their strong resistance to pitting and crevice corrosion. For example, in the fertilizer production process, equipment may come into contact with ammonia water or nitric acid. Using 316L material can reduce the risk of leakage and extend the lifespan of the equipment. 3. Construction and decoration field. 316L stainless steel sheet can be used for outdoor building components, such as facades, railings, and roofing materials. In coastal areas, high salt content in the air can easily cause metal corrosion, but 316L's resistance to salt fog makes it suitable for such environments. For example, some seaside hotels use this material for their decorative panels to maintain a long-lasting aesthetic appearance. 4. Ships and marine engineering. Ship components such as pumps, valves, pipes, and deck equipment are often manufactured using 316L stainless steel plates. The seawater environment is highly corrosive, and the material needs to resist chloride ion erosion. In practical cases, the water supply system of cargo ships uses 316L pipes, reducing maintenance frequency. Similarly, structural components of offshore platforms may also use this material to ensure stability in harsh environments.
5. Application in the energy industry. In the oil or gas sector, 316L stainless steel sheet are used to manufacture storage tanks and transportation pipelines. For instance, certain equipment in refineries comes into contact with sulfur-containing media, and the material must be resistant to high-temperature corrosion. In practice, pipeline systems are processed using 316L plates to cope with complex conditions.
